Summer Programs

OutLoud provides FREE summer art programs for middle and high school youth at sites throughout the community. Please check out our 2024 offerings and email Allison@WeAreOutLoud.org with any questions.

Summer Arts Intensive at the Latino Cultural Center

June 10 - June 28

Monday - Friday, 9am - 5pm

Ages 11 - 14

Participating youth will rotate through daily performing and visual arts sessions led by local artists, working towards a culminating performance and gallery show for parents and community members.

Public
Exhibition Projects

Session #1: July 16 - 18, 1pm - 5pm

Session #2: July 23 - 25, 1pm - 5pm

Session #3: July 30 - August 1, 1pm - 5pm

Rising High School Sophomores - Seniors

Work on projects that use filmmaking, creative photo shoots, writing and theater to help create multidisciplinary public exhibitions that will premiere in the fall and spring.

Projects include a touring exhibition, See Me, that features immersive projections and holograms; Can You Hear Me?, an immersive Halloween exhibition and walk-through performance, and It Was All A Dream, a pop-up storytelling exhibition traveling to movie theater lobbies across the metroplex.
